About Prophetstown Elem School
Prophetstown Elem School is a charming elementary school nestled in the rural setting of Prophetstown, Illinois. Serving students from pre-kindergarten through third grade, it has an enrollment of 234 students and employs 15 full-time equivalent teachers. The student-to-teacher ratio stands at 15.6:1, ensuring that each child receives personalized attention.
Academically, the school maintains a MySchoolScout rating of 6.2 out of 10 and ranks 1285th among all schools in Illinois based on state metrics, placing it in the 66th percentile. The academic score is rated at 7.3/10, with 34% of students proficient or above in math and 33% proficient or above in ELA/Reading. While there's room for improvement in test scores, Prophetstown Elem School remains dedicated to fostering a supportive learning environment that encourages student development.
Located on West Third Street, the school is part of the rural community of Prophetstown, offering students a close-knit setting where they can thrive and grow.

Community Profile
The community surrounding Prophetstown Elem School has a median household income of $72,837. It is a community where 16%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$134,000, with a median rent of $735/month. The local poverty rate of 7.6%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 26 minutes.
